#cc2c98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cc2c98 is composed of 80% red, 17.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 78.4% magenta, 25.5%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 319.5 degrees, a saturation of 64.5% and a lightness of 48.6%. #cc2c98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ff58ff with #990031.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

#cc2c98 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#cc2c98 has RGB values of R:204, G:44,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.78, Y:0.25,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 13380760.
